Abstract

This study aims to influence the use of Domika learning media through the Make a Match learning model to improve Mathematics learning outcomes. The method used in this research is quantitative research with the type of research Quasi-Experimental Design. This research was conducted at Food I Elementary School and addressed Jl Gate Food Village Paberasan District city Sumenep Kab Sumenep. The research sample consisted of grade III students divided into experimental and control classes. The results of data analysis show that the use of domika media in learning Mathematics has a positive impact on student learning outcomes. Normality and homogeneity tests show that the data is usually distributed and has a homogeneous variance, allowing the use of parametric statistical tests. Hypothesis testing using Baron & Kenny's mediation method revealed a significant influence of using domika media on improving students' learning outcomes. The findings show that in addition to students' initial scores (pretest), the improvement in learning outcomes is also mediated by the effectiveness of the learning methods. The study results conclude that house learning media influences the Make-a-Match model, which has a role in improving student learning outcomes
